10kg/h Brine Electrolysis Sodium Hypochlorite Generator
Geemblue’s Sodium Hypo Generator offers several significant advantages for water treatment facilities:
Minimal Maintenance Requirements: The 0.8% sodium hypochlorite solution produced requires minimal cleaning and maintenance of injection nozzles due to its non-aggressive and low-mineral content.
Stability and Longevity: Unlike conventional sodium hypochlorite solutions, Geemblue’s solution remains stable over months without additives, ensuring consistent chlorine levels for effective disinfection.
Safety and Operational Efficiency: Produced onsite, the system reduces risks associated with storage and handling, enhancing safety for operational personnel and minimizing the chances of accidental spillage.
Raw Materials: Uses salt or seawater for electrolysis, which are safe and easy to transport and store, with no volatility or toxicity concerns.
Efficiency Standards: Meets or exceeds national standards for salt and power consumption, ensuring cost-effective operation.
Control System: Equipped with Siemens PLC and touch screen for automatic control, ensuring precision and ease of use.
Longevity of Components: Critical components such as the cathode and machine itself have extended lifespans, reducing maintenance costs and downtime.

| Model | GBA-10K-NACLO |
| Dimension of Host Machine | 2000*1200*2050mm |
| Available chlorine | 10kg/h |
| NaClO Output flow | 1250L/h |
| NaClO concentration | 8000ppm |
| Power supply | 60kw |
| Voltage | 380V/50hz three phase |
| Feed brine concentration | 2.5~3% |
| Feed Salt requirement | 99.3% food grade salt |
| Feed water flow | 1250L/h |
| Feed water requirement | tap water |
| Salt Consumption | 3.5kg/kg Cl2 |
| AC Power consumption | 4kw/kg Cl2 |
| Cell arrangement | Horizontal |
| H2 production amount | 0.35m3/kg Cl2 |
| Number of Cell6 | pcs |
| Operation pressure | 2~4bar |
| Feed water temperature | 15~25℃ |
| Dosing system | Optional |
| Residual chlorine analyser | Optional |
| Heating/Cooling device | Optional |
| Operation mode | Full automatic control, real-time display parameters of the system and running status of each component |
| Detection Unit | Voltage/current detection, Temperature detection, conductivity detection, pressure detection, H8 detection, Component status detection |
| Cleaning mode | Acid washing |
